The recommended operating temperature range for the 4N37S is -40°C to 100°C.
To ensure reliability in high-temperature applications, it is recommended to derate the device's current and voltage ratings according to the datasheet's thermal derating curve.
The maximum allowable voltage for the 4N37S is 80V, but it is recommended to operate the device at a voltage below 60V to ensure reliable operation.
The correct resistor value for the input LED of the 4N37S can be calculated using the formula: R = (Vcc - Vf) / If, where Vcc is the supply voltage, Vf is the forward voltage of the LED, and If is the desired forward current.
The typical propagation delay time for the 4N37S is around 2-3 microseconds, but this can vary depending on the specific application and operating conditions.
